Output 3433e8e5de3fe0a06e40b3369a04e6f4b671c51134e20505d7fa3a7bd2dc8f4d:0

value
6399300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c571cc9db15b0b065622a6e3ab7b3abc144536 OP_EQUAL
address
39EfrxeL5KRy6QpaAcJYa72UkhohND9JfS
transaction
3433e8e5de3fe0a06e40b3369a04e6f4b671c51134e20505d7fa3a7bd2dc8f4d
confirmations
398714
spent
true